Output 70a227debbb71f8010ee770ef3fe1a9c28324c1a99ea501dbe8713760548afca:25

value
352596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da3bf1ea422afe07e8edda45798d18cc25fd4c1 OP_EQUAL
address
3MtwRFPG5fG37dCcYuKwPYxn3KxbHiTj4m
transaction
70a227debbb71f8010ee770ef3fe1a9c28324c1a99ea501dbe8713760548afca
spent
true